Terrific Chicken Tetrazzini
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 15 Minutes
Cook Time: 30 Minutes
Ready In: 45 Minutes
Servings: 12
This recipe is a result of my search for the perfect tetrazzini. It is a compilation and adaptation of several recipes. It is one of my most requested recipes. It makes a 9x13 pan completely full, so is great for entertaining company. It is very easy to put together and can be assembled early and then baked at serving time. Fix a nice green salad and some garlic bread and your meal is ready.
Ingredients:
16 ounces spaghetti noodles
1 (15 ounce) can mushroom stems and pieces, drained
1 onion, chopped
1/4 cup butter
3 (10 3/4 ounce) cans cream of chicken soup
4 cups diced cooked chicken meat
24 ounces sour cream
salt and pepper
1 cup cheddar cheese, finely shredded
1 cup italian seasoned breadcrumbs
1/2 cup butter
Directions:
1. Break spaghetti into small pieces, cook according to package directions. Drain and set aside.
2. Melt the 1/4 cup butter in a large saucepan.
3. Sauté the onions and mushrooms until the onions are tender.
4. Stir in the soup and chicken and heat.
5. Stir in the sour cream and then the noodles. Add salt and pepper to taste.
6. Pour the mixture into a greased 9x13 pan or a large casserole dish.
7. Top with topping and then bake at 350 degrees for 30 minutes.
8. Topping: Melt the stick of butter and stir in the breadcrumbs and cheese. Spread on top of noodle mixture.
